Kottayam: The Piravom pipe bomb probe reached a successful culmination on Monday with the arrest of Santhosh, the accomplice of Senthil, who together planted the bomb on the railway track near Piravom Road Railway station on Thursday.

Santhosh, 35, of Mudasseril house, Veliyandu at Edakkattuvayal, was held from his hiding place at a rubber plantation at Edakkattuvayal, a few km from his residence. Senthil had been arrested from Shoranur on Saturday. Santhosh’s relative, Anoop, 24, of Manakkapparambil house, Mrala, near Thodupuzha, who provided him ammonium nitrate and detonators, was also taken into custody and interrogated.

The probe team unearthed six detonators from another rubber plantation near Santhosh’s house. The police team headed by Kottayam SP C Rajagopal quizzed Santhosh. He was taken to various places connected with the case and confessed to his part in the crime, police said. He had attempted suicide while in hiding and sustained injuries on his head, police said.
